Ton'ya (問屋), called toiya outside of Edo, were trade brokers in Japan, primarily wholesalers, warehouse managers, and shipment managers; the term applies equally to the traders themselves and to their shops or warehouses. Japan 's service industries, including trade, are the major contributor to gross national product (GNP), generating about 74.1 percent of the national totals in 2004. YO! Company is a British holding company wholly owned by entrepreneur Simon Woodroffe. [1] The YO! Company has several subsidiary companies and brands including: YOTEL - a chain of capsule hotels at airports and various cities. YO! Japan - A Japanese-inspired clothing brand. RadiYO! - a series of radio shows about business.
